Christian Publishers Commit to Delivering Majority of Catalogs to Amazon Kindle Owners by the End of 2008

Top Christian Publishers Adding Thousands More Kindle Books

SEATTLE, Jul 14, 2008 (BUSINESS WIRE) --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N), today announced that Christian
book publishers Augsburg Fortress, Crossway Books & Bibles, David C.
Cook, Gospel Light, Group Publishing, NavPress, Strang Communications,
Thomas Nelson, Tyndale, Wm. B. Eerdmans Publishing Co. and Zondervan
have committed to making the majority of their catalogs of books
available to Kindle owners by the end of 2008. Anywhere they happen to
be, and in less than 60 seconds, Kindle customers will be able to
download and start reading favorite Christian titles such as
"Boundaries," "Walking With God," and "When the Game Is Over." Kindle
is Amazon's portable reader that wirelessly downloads books, blogs,
magazines and newspapers to a crisp, high-resolution electronic paper
display that looks and reads like real paper. For more information on

"Of the 135,000 books available on Amazon.com as a physical book
and on Kindle, Kindle books already account for over 12 percent of
units sold," said Ian Freed, Vice President of Amazon Kindle. "We're
pleased that so many publishers are seeing this success with their
Kindle titles, and that more publishers like the Christian book
publishers are getting on board."

Amazon has increased the number of book titles available on Kindle
from 90,000 to 135,000 since Kindle was introduced last November, with
more books being added every day. Kindle books are available for
wireless download in less than 60 seconds and The New York Times Best
Sellers and New Releases are $9.99 or less on Kindle, unless marked
otherwise. Dozens of newspapers, magazines and blogs have also been
added. Newspaper subscriptions, such as The New York Times and The
Wall Street Journal, and magazines, such as TIME and Newsweek, are
auto-delivered wirelessly to Kindle overnight so the latest edition is
waiting for customers when they wake up. Blogs, such as TechCrunch and
All Things D, are updated and downloaded wirelessly throughout the day
so Kindle customers can read blogs whenever and wherever they want.
